1. What is a Diagnostic GM Car Code Reader?

A diagnostic GM car code reader is an electronic device used to access and interpret the diagnostic information stored within a General Motors (GM) vehicle’s onboard computer system. According to a study by the National Institute for Automotive Service Excellence (ASE) in 2023, diagnostic tools have become indispensable for modern automotive repair, with over 80% of certified technicians relying on them daily. This tool plugs into the vehicle’s OBD-II (On-Board Diagnostics II) port, typically located under the dashboard.

  • It communicates with the car’s computer to retrieve diagnostic trouble codes (DTCs).
  • These DTCs indicate specific problems within the vehicle’s systems, such as the engine, transmission, or emissions controls.
  • The code reader translates these codes into a readable format, providing descriptions of the issues.
  • Advanced readers can also display live data, such as engine speed, sensor readings, and other performance parameters.

4. Types of Diagnostic GM Car Code Readers

There are several types of diagnostic GM car code readers available, each with its own features and capabilities.

4.1. Basic OBD-II Code Readers

Basic OBD-II code readers are the simplest and most affordable type of diagnostic tool.

  • Functionality: These readers primarily retrieve and display diagnostic trouble codes (DTCs).
  • Features: They typically include a small screen for displaying codes and a button for clearing codes.
  • Use Case: Suitable for basic diagnostics, such as checking the cause of a check engine light.
  • Price Range: Generally priced between $20 and $50.

4.2. Enhanced Code Readers

Enhanced code readers offer more advanced features compared to basic models.

  • Functionality: In addition to reading and clearing DTCs, they can display live data and perform some system tests.
  • Features: They often include a larger screen, more detailed code descriptions, and the ability to graph live data.
  • Use Case: Suitable for DIYers and technicians who need more detailed diagnostic information.
  • Price Range: Typically priced between $50 and $200.

4.3. Professional Scan Tools

Professional scan tools are high-end diagnostic devices used by automotive technicians.

  • Functionality: These tools offer comprehensive diagnostic capabilities, including reading and clearing DTCs, displaying live data, performing advanced system tests, and reprogramming vehicle modules.
  • Features: They often include a large color touchscreen, wireless connectivity, and access to vehicle-specific diagnostic information.
  • Use Case: Ideal for professional repair shops and dealerships.
  • Price Range: Can range from $200 to several thousand dollars.

4.4. Smartphone-Based Code Readers

Smartphone-based code readers use a Bluetooth or Wi-Fi adapter that connects to the OBD-II port and communicates with a smartphone app.

  • Functionality: These readers can perform many of the same functions as enhanced code readers, with the added convenience of using a smartphone as the display.
  • Features: They often include a user-friendly app interface, data logging, and the ability to share diagnostic information.
  • Use Case: Suitable for DIYers and enthusiasts who want a portable and versatile diagnostic tool.
  • Price Range: Typically priced between $50 and $150, plus the cost of the app (some apps are free, while others require a subscription).

4.5. All-System Scanners

All-system scanners can access and diagnose all of the electronic control units (ECUs) in a vehicle, not just the engine and transmission.

  • Functionality: These scanners can read and clear DTCs from systems such as ABS, airbags, climate control, and more.
  • Features: They often include advanced features such as bidirectional control, which allows the user to command the vehicle’s systems to perform specific actions.
  • Use Case: Ideal for technicians who need to diagnose complex issues affecting multiple vehicle systems.
  • Price Range: Typically priced between $200 and several thousand dollars.

7. How to Use a Diagnostic GM Car Code Reader

Using a diagnostic GM car code reader is a straightforward process.

  1. Locate the OBD-II Port: The OBD-II port is typically located under the dashboard, near the steering column.
  2. Plug in the Code Reader: Connect the code reader to the OBD-II port.
  3. Turn on the Ignition: Turn the ignition key to the “on” position, but do not start the engine.
  4. Power on the Code Reader: Turn on the code reader and follow the on-screen instructions.
  5. Read the Codes: Select the option to read diagnostic trouble codes (DTCs). The code reader will display any stored codes.
  6. Interpret the Codes: Use the code reader’s built-in code definitions or consult a repair manual to interpret the codes.
  7. Clear the Codes (Optional): If desired, you can clear the codes after addressing the underlying issue. Be aware that clearing codes may erase important diagnostic information.
  8. Disconnect the Code Reader: Once you have finished, disconnect the code reader from the OBD-II port.

8. Understanding Diagnostic Trouble Codes (DTCs)

Diagnostic trouble codes (DTCs) are standardized codes used to identify specific problems within a vehicle’s systems.

  • Structure: DTCs consist of a five-character alphanumeric code.
  • First Character: Indicates the system affected (e.g., P for powertrain, B for body, C for chassis, U for network).
  • Second Character: Indicates whether the code is generic (0) or manufacturer-specific (1).
  • Third Character: Indicates the specific subsystem affected (e.g., 1 for fuel and air metering, 2 for fuel and air metering – injector circuit).
  • Fourth and Fifth Characters: Provide further details about the specific fault.

8.1. Common GM Diagnostic Trouble Codes

Here are some common GM diagnostic trouble codes:

  • P0171: System Too Lean (Bank 1)
  • P0300: Random/Multiple Cylinder Misfire Detected
  • P0420: Catalyst System Efficiency Below Threshold (Bank 1)
  • P0442: Evaporative Emission Control System Leak Detected (Small Leak)
  • P0455: Evaporative Emission Control System Leak Detected (Gross Leak)

8.2. Interpreting DTCs

To interpret a DTC, consult a repair manual or use a code reader with built-in code definitions. The code definition will provide a description of the problem and potential causes.

12. FAQ About Diagnostic GM Car Code Readers

12.1. What is an OBD-II port?

The OBD-II (On-Board Diagnostics II) port is a standardized connector used to access a vehicle’s onboard computer system.

12.2. Where is the OBD-II port located?

The OBD-II port is typically located under the dashboard, near the steering column.

12.3. What is a DTC?

DTC stands for Diagnostic Trouble Code, a standardized code used to identify specific problems within a vehicle’s systems.

12.4. How do I read DTCs?

To read DTCs, you need a diagnostic code reader that connects to the OBD-II port.

12.5. Can I clear DTCs myself?

Yes, you can clear DTCs yourself using a diagnostic code reader. However, be aware that clearing codes may erase important diagnostic information.

12.6. What is live data?

Live data refers to real-time information about a vehicle’s systems, such as engine speed, sensor readings, and other performance parameters.

12.7. What is bidirectional control?

Bidirectional control allows the user to command the vehicle’s systems to perform specific actions, such as activating a fuel injector or turning on a cooling fan.

12.8. How do I update my code reader?

To update your code reader, follow the manufacturer’s instructions. This typically involves connecting the code reader to a computer and downloading the latest software.

12.9. What is CAN bus?

CAN (Controller Area Network) bus is a communication protocol used in vehicles to allow different electronic control units (ECUs) to communicate with each other.

12.10. What is VIN?

VIN stands for Vehicle Identification Number, a unique code assigned to each vehicle. The VIN can be used to identify the vehicle’s make, model, year, and other information.

13. Real-World Examples of Using Diagnostic GM Car Code Readers

  • Example 1: A car owner notices the check engine light is on in their GM vehicle. They use a basic OBD-II code reader to retrieve the code P0171, which indicates a lean condition in the engine. They consult a repair manual and find that potential causes include a vacuum leak or a faulty oxygen sensor. They inspect the engine and find a cracked vacuum hose. After replacing the hose, they clear the code and the check engine light turns off.
  • Example 2: A professional technician is diagnosing a GM vehicle with a transmission problem. They use a professional scan tool to read DTCs from the transmission control module (TCM). They find a code indicating a faulty shift solenoid. They use the scan tool’s bidirectional control feature to activate the solenoid and confirm that it is not functioning properly. They replace the solenoid and clear the code, resolving the transmission problem.
  • Example 3: A used car buyer is considering purchasing a GM vehicle. They use a smartphone-based code reader to check for hidden problems before making the purchase. The code reader finds a code indicating a problem with the ABS system. The buyer uses this information to negotiate a lower price or to have the seller repair the problem before the sale.
